What does it mean to be an Registered Agent?
The registered agent is the designated entity tasked with handling legal papers on behalf of the business or organization. It includes key documents such as service of process papers, tax notifications, and annual report reminders. A registered agent functions as the official point of contact for the business and the state, ensuring that the business remains in compliance with state regulations.
In various jurisdictions, having a registered agent is a legal requirement for forming and maintaining a business entity, whether it is an LLC or a corporate corporation. The registered agent must have a physical address within the state where the business conducts business, which can be either a home or business location. This ensures that the agent is available during regular business hours to receive key documents.

Cost of Registered Agent Solutions
When evaluating the expenses associated with registered agent solutions, businesses should be cognizant that the expenses can fluctuate significantly based on multiple factors. The type of registered agent provider you choose, whether it is a community-based, corporate, or online registered agent, will play a crucial role in affecting the overall cost. On in general, businesses can forecast to pay anywhere from $100 to 300 dollars per year for reliable registered agent services. However, budget-conscious entrepreneurs can discover affordable registered agent alternatives that may levy rates at the lower end of this spectrum.
It is important to observe that beyond the primary fee, there may be further costs associated with particular services. For instance, some registered agent firms provide premium features such as mail forwarding, compliance notifications, and annual report handling for an incremental fee. Businesses should assess these features diligently to ensure they select a registered agent service that meets their needs without incurring unnecessary avoidable expenses. The Registered Agent Update
Changing the registered agent is a straightforward process that ensures your business remains compliant with state regulations. Whether it’s due to a relocation, a change in business strategy, or simply a desire for better service, you can easily update your registered agent information. Most states allow you to alter your registered agent by filing a designated form with the Secretary of State or appropriate regulatory authority. This form typically requires details about the business and the replacement registered agent you wish to designate.
